Eurovision 2023 in Liverpool, final on May 13th

Robin Tas (Netherlands)

On Friday October 7th, the European Broadcasting Union announced that Liverpool has been selected to host the Eurovision Song Contest 2023. The semi finals will take place on 9 and 11 May, while the Grand Final will be held on May 13.

Armenia wins Junior Eurovision 2021

Robin Tas (Netherlands)

Meléna from Armenia has won the 18th edition of the Junior Eurovision Song Contest. The final took place on December 19th, 2021 in Paris.
